Global Automotive Fifth Wheel Coupler Market (USD Million), 2020 - 2030
In the year 2023, the Global Automotive Fifth Wheel Coupler Market was valued at USD 4009.00 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 5275.57 million by the year 2030,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.0%.
The Global Automotive Fifth Wheel Coupler Market plays a pivotal role in the efficient coupling and towing of heavy-duty vehicles, facilitating safe transportation across diverse industries. Fifth wheel couplers, crucial components in tractor-trailer systems, ensure secure attachment between the tractor unit and the trailer, enabling smooth maneuverability and stability during transit. Global Automotive Fifth Wheel Coupler Market Recent Developments
-
In November 2022, JOST decided to expand its operations in Dubai. The newly established office would is offering products like fifth wheel coupling, landing gears, trailers axels, and kingpins.
-
In June 2022, Paige Petroni was appointed the president of Fontaine Fifth Wheel. She has been associated with the company for fourteen years and has served a number of domains, that include finance, Sales, and also as a Company Controller.
Segment Analysis
The Global Automotive Fifth Wheel Coupler Market is segmented by product type, vehicle type, and sales channel, each contributing uniquely to the overall dynamics of the market. By product type, the market is divided into Compensating Fifth Wheel Couplers, Semi-Oscillating Fifth Wheel Couplers, and Fully Oscillating Fifth Wheel Couplers. The Compensating Fifth Wheel Coupler is widely used for its ability to handle variations in height between the towing vehicle and the trailer, providing greater stability and improved weight distribution. This type is particularly important in heavy-duty applications where secure connections are critical for safety and performance. The Semi-Oscillating Fifth Wheel Coupler allows for moderate movement, making it suitable for vehicles that experience standard towing conditions and require a flexible yet stable connection. The Fully Oscillating Fifth Wheel Coupler offers the most freedom of movement, which is crucial for heavy-duty vehicles that need significant articulation during turning or maneuvering in tight spaces. Each of these product types addresses different performance needs, from light-duty vehicles to high-demand heavy-duty trucks and trailers.
By vehicle type, the market is segmented into Light-Duty Vehicles and Heavy-Duty Vehicles. Light-Duty Vehicles, such as pickup trucks and smaller commercial vehicles, typically require less robust fifth wheel couplers compared to their heavy-duty counterparts. These vehicles are often used for lighter towing and less intense hauling tasks, so couplers designed for this segment focus on providing reliability and ease of use for smaller-scale operations. In contrast, Heavy-Duty Vehicles, including long-haul trucks, trailers, and semi-trucks, rely on more durable and high-performance fifth wheel couplers due to the heavier loads they carry and the demanding nature of their operations. These couplers must withstand substantial stress and weight, often requiring features like compensating or oscillating mechanisms to ensure stability and safe towing during high-performance or long-duration operations. The heavy-duty segment is a major driver of market growth, especially with the increasing demand for efficient logistics and freight transportation.

Safety risks from improper installation - Safety risks from improper installation pose a significant restraint to the global automotive fifth wheel coupler market. Despite advancements in technology and design, improper installation of fifth wheel couplers can lead to serious safety hazards, including coupling failure, trailer detachment, and loss of control while towing. Factors such as incorrect mounting, inadequate torque application, and improper alignment can compromise the integrity and effectiveness of the coupler, increasing the risk of accidents and injuries on the road.
Improper installation may result from human error, lack of proper training, or inadequate maintenance practices. In some cases, users may attempt to install fifth wheel couplers without following manufacturer guidelines or using the appropriate tools and techniques, leading to critical errors that compromise safety. Additionally, insufficient oversight and inspection during installation processes can contribute to overlooked issues that may manifest as safety concerns during operation.
Addressing safety risks from improper installation requires comprehensive education, training, and awareness initiatives targeted at both end-users and service providers. Manufacturers play a crucial role in providing clear and detailed installation instructions, along with training programs to ensure that installers have the necessary knowledge and skills to perform installations correctly. Regular inspections and maintenance checks can also help identify and rectify installation errors before they escalate into safety hazards.
